Facilities & Administrative (F&A) Rates
Fringe Benefit Rates

Per University policy, fringe benefits are charged on all salaries for University employees working on sponsored projects. 

This includes part-time employees, anyone at less than 50% appointment. If the employee is not benefit eligible, there is still a reduced fringe benefit rate to cover workers comp, etc., charged to the contract/grant. The current fringe benefit rate for part-time employees is available through the links below on the Campus Controller’s Office Webpage.

Graduate Research Assistant Support (Salaries & Tuition)

Graduate Research Assistants (GRAs) are supported on sponsored research projects per a monthly contracted salary. The Graduate School establishes the varying rates used by colleges, departments and institutes based on students' qualification. Current rates for 0.5 FTE are outlined in the tables below.

Tuition remission for GRA is estimated in accordance with the eligibility requirements set in the Graduate Student Appointment Manual. Eligibility is based on GRAs percent of effort for each academic semester. The per credit hour rates are established each academic year by CU Boulder Bursar's Office. GRA salary and tuition must be charged proportionally.


Effective 8/15/2023

Campus Minimum: 50% time, monthly rate: $2,792.84

These amounts are only in effect for AY or 12 month appointments and need to be adjusted if students are appointed for single terms.
